This may be a silly question, but if I use a full respec token, my boons get reset, right. Do I have to go through all of the steps and pay all the resources to re-buy the boons?

    Yes, a Retraining Token (not to be confused with the AD costing Respec Button found on the Feats page), will respec Feats, Ability Scores, Powers and Boons you have chosen from the level up process and campaigns for that specific character.

    The respec button found on the Feats page will only respec your Feats for a nominal AD fee.

    To fully respec, look on your Powers Page instead and if you have any Retraining Tokens applied to that character, you'll be able to press the Respec Button there and then choose to either use a Free token or a Purchased one.

    And to be clear, no you don't "re-buy" anything. The points are reset and you can allocate to the boons as you see fit.
